Movement Alert|Celestica Rises 5.05% in Pre-Market Trading, Q2 Earnings Beat Effect Continues Amid Sector Recovery

Market Focus
07/30

On July 30, Celestica rose 5.05% in pre-market trading, trading at 345.7 USD/share, with turnover of $5.3489 million. The stock rebounded following the previous session's 5.31% decline alongside broader sector pressure.

The recovery is driven by the continuation of strong Q2 earnings momentum and a broad-based rebound in the Electronic Manufacturing Services sector. Celestica reported Q2 revenue of $4.7 billion, up 62% year-over-year and well above the $4.33 billion consensus estimate. Adjusted EPS came in at $2.54, beating the $2.27 estimate by nearly 12%. The company raised full-year revenue guidance to $20.5 billion and adjusted EPS to $11.30, both significantly above prior forecasts. Management indicated 2027 revenue growth would accelerate further, supported by new program wins and strong AI infrastructure demand.

RBC Capital Markets raised its price target to $450 from $440, citing market share gains from strong execution and synergies between design and manufacturing. The broader sector also recovered, with TTM Technologies up 7.12%, Fabrinet up 4.70%, Flex up 3.87%, Jabil up 3.45%, and TE Connectivity up 0.58%.
